WebMar 10, 2024 · Promote women’s leadership and gender equality in governance models; Prevent and respond to gender-based violence; Undertake to close the gap in investment in women’s sport and promote equal economic opportunities for women and girls; Promote women’s equal participation and bias free representation in media Appoint more women to board positions. Adding more women to the board can help ensure greater gender parity as companies evaluate candidates for senior-leadership positions. Board diversity can help to draw in and motivate more talented employees from a broader set of backgrounds.
